Thin layer chromatography is performed on a sheet of glass, plastic, or aluminium foil, which is coated with a thin layer of adsorbent material, usually silica gel, aluminium oxide alumina, or cellulose. Development of thin layer chromatography of amino acids lagged somewhat compared to techniques for separation of lipophilic substances, partly because of the highly satisfactory separations obtained by paper chromatography.
